Care & Maintenance of weir flow meter
Proper maintenance of weir flow meter requires regular inspection of the flow channel to eliminate any obstacles that could disrupt water movement. The presence of silt, vegetation, and debris must be removed because they create measurement errors. The inspections must identify any structural components that show signs of wear, erosion, or damage from environmental conditions. The measuring section experiences less stress when water levels and flow conditions remain constant throughout the process. The accuracy of weir flow meter measurements requires verification through comparison with reference flow data. The team must conduct regular inspections of all monitoring and data acquisition connections to confirm their secure performance. FAQ
Q: What is the expected lifespan of a Weir Flow Meter? A: With proper maintenance and protective measures, Weir Flow Meter can provide reliable operation for many years. Q: Are Weir Flow Meter affected by sedimentation? A: Yes, sediment buildup can distort measurements, so periodic cleaning is essential. Q: Can Weir Flow Meter be used in industrial water channels? A: Absolutely, they monitor flow in open channels within industrial and processing facilities. Q: How do Weir Flow Meter handle changes in flow velocity? A: They measure water depth over the weir structure, which reflects overall discharge despite variations in velocity. Q: Are Weir Flow Meter compatible with automated alert systems? A: Yes, they can trigger monitoring alerts if water levels or flow rates exceed predefined thresholds.
